[发明专利]一种Android中双边圆形进度条的绘制方法及Android电子设备在审

专利信息
申请号: 201810677512.X 申请日: 2018-06-27
公开(公告)号: CN110716770A 公开(公告)日: 2020-01-21
发明(设计)人: 张磊;陈少杰;张文明 申请(专利权)人: 武汉斗鱼网络科技有限公司
主分类号: G06F9/451 分类号: G06F9/451;G06F9/445
代理公司: 11021 中科专利商标代理有限责任公司 代理人: 周天宇
地址: 430000 湖北省武汉市武汉东湖*** 国省代码: 湖北;42
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 矩形边框 进度条 绘制 电子设备 视觉体验 角设置 圆角
【说明书】:

本公开提供了一种Android中双边圆形进度条的绘制方法及Android电子设备,方法包括:设置进度条的属性;在背景中绘制一个背景矩形边框,并对背景矩形边框的四个角设置为圆角;在前景中绘制一个宽度与所述背景矩形边框宽度相同的前景矩形边框,并设置一个放缩参数,以对前景矩形边框的长度进行放缩。本公开能够在Android系统的视图中绘制出双边圆形进度条,提高了用户的视觉体验。

技术领域

本公开涉及一种Android中双边圆形进度条的绘制方法及Android电子设备。

背景技术

随着软件技术的发展,越来越多的个性化界面提供给了用户。通常,用户在使用电子设备时,会出现等待的情形,例如等待程序运行完成、等待页面加载成功,还例如,在一些直播平台中会有抽奖功能,观看直播的用户需要等待开奖的结果。针对上述这些情形,用户界面会提供一个进度条,用于显示这些事件的进行程度,有点进度条会显示完成的百分比,还有的进度条会提示还剩余的时间。

然而,针对Android系统的客户端,其呈现的进度条往往是规则矩形的,即进度条的顶端和末端是矩形的,或者仅仅能够通过改变样式来设置一边为圆形另外一边为矩形,无法实现两边都是矩形的设计要求。

上述进度条的样式过于老化,并且Android系统也无法提供进度条两边都呈圆形的样式,无法保证界面的美观。

发明内容

本公开鉴于上述问题,提供一种Android中双边圆形进度条的绘制方法及Android电子设备,能够在Android系统的界面中呈现出顶端和末端都是圆形的双边圆形进度条,提高了用户的视觉体验。

本公开一方面提供一种Android中双边圆形进度条的绘制方法,包括:S1,设置进度条的id信息、通用样式信息、位置信息、初始进度值信息及背景信息;S2,通过设置一个item标签,用于表示对所述背景进行绘制,再通过设置一个shape1标签,用于表示在所述背景中绘制一个背景矩形边框,在所述shape1标签内部设置一个圆角标签,以使得所述背景矩形边框的双边为圆形;S3,定义一个lot_progress_vertical文件,并在所述lot_progress_vertical文件中设置一个shape2标签,用于表示在所述前景中绘制一个前景矩形边框,在所述shape2标签内部设置一个圆角标签,以使得所述背景矩形边框的双边为圆形,将所述lot_progress_vertical文件加载至一个scale标签中,所述scale标签用于对所述前景矩形边框的长度进行放缩。

可选地,在所述步骤S2中,定义一个item标签表示对进度条的背景来进行绘制:<item android:id=@android:id/background></item>,其中,所述item标签关联于Android系统提供的常量@android:id/background,用于表示对进度条背景的说明;

在<item android:id=@android:id/background></item>标签内部绘制背景信息,用于绘制出了一个形状为rectangle的背景矩形边框。

可选地,在所述步骤S3中,调用<solid android:color=X/>来设置前景矩形边框的颜色,其中,X为颜色值。

可选地,在所述步骤S3中,在所述lot_progress_vertical文件中设置一个shape2标签,包括:<shape android:shape=rectangle></shape>,用于表示在前景中绘制一个前景矩形边框。

可选地,在所述步骤S3还包括,通过调用android:scaleHeight=Y%/>设置前景矩形边框的缩放最大高度信息,其中,Y%表示缩放百分比。

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于武汉斗鱼网络科技有限公司,未经武汉斗鱼网络科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/201810677512.X/2.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top